The open-frame construction allows the monitor to be installed inside a customer's own enclosure rather than relying on a finished monitor housing. This makes it easier to develop flush-mounted interfaces for equipment panels, kiosks, cabinets, and customized terminals. VESA 75 mm and 100 mm mounting interfaces, together with horizontal and vertical bracket options, provide additional flexibility during mechanical design. For equipment manufacturers and integrators, this means the display can be considered as a component within the overall system architecture, helping the mechanical structure remain focused on the final product rather than adapting around a conventional monitor.

Different equipment requires different amounts of screen space, so the HOP170-8 series supports display sizes from 10.1 inch to 32 inch. Available resolution configurations include 1024 * 768, 1280 * 1024, 1440 * 900, and 1920 * 1080, allowing the display specification to be matched to the interface layout and host system. This range is useful for businesses developing multiple equipment models or customer-specific configurations, because screen size and resolution can be selected according to the available installation area and visual requirements. Instead of treating every display requirement as an entirely separate sourcing project, buyers can work from a broader open-frame display platform.

The touchscreen configuration can be selected between resistive and capacitive touch, depending on how the final equipment is expected to be operated. The touch panel provides up to 92% light transmission, a stated 2 ms response time, and a touch life cycle of up to 50 million touches. USB serves as the touch system interface, allowing the monitor to work with the customer's host system as an interactive input device. This gives developers more flexibility when designing machine interfaces, kiosks, control panels, and other interactive equipment where the display needs to handle repeated operator input rather than simply provide visual output.

The HOP170-8 supports VGA and DVI video inputs, while HDMI is available as an optional configuration. This helps accommodate different host platforms and existing equipment architectures without making the display dependent on one particular video interface. The monitor can operate as the visual and touch interface while the customer's industrial computer, controller, media player, or other host device handles application processing. For system integration projects, this separation can simplify hardware selection and allow the display configuration to be evaluated independently from the computing platform. The appropriate interface can then be selected according to the video output available from the final system.

The standard luminance is specified at 350 cd/m², with an optional configuration reaching 1000 cd/m². This gives project teams an additional display option when the equipment needs stronger screen visibility under brighter ambient conditions. The panel also provides a 1000:1 contrast ratio, 16.2 million colors, and a 5 ms response time for general interactive display applications. Rather than selecting a high-brightness configuration by default, buyers can evaluate the actual installation environment and choose the appropriate luminance level based on where and how the finished equipment will be used.
Integration does not end with selecting the right panel. The display must also be installed accurately and adjusted after it is connected to the final system. VESA 75 mm and 100 mm mounting options, together with horizontal and vertical mounting brackets, provide several ways to position the monitor within the equipment structure. The built-in OSD also provides controls for brightness, contrast, auto-adjust, phase, clock, horizontal and vertical positioning, language, function settings, and reset. These controls allow installers and technicians to fine-tune the display after installation, which can be useful when the final viewing position and ambient conditions differ from the original development environment.
